      ATEX, which stands for “Atmospheres Explosibles,” is a European standard that specifies the minimum requirements for the design and manufacture of equipment used in potentially explosive atmospheres. ATEX tactical work flashlights are designed to meet these stringent safety standards, making them ideal for use in environments where flammable gases, vapors, or dust may be present.       **Understanding General Purpose Relays**

      A general purpose relay is a type of electromagnetic switch that is designed to handle a wide range of electrical currents and voltages. These relays are versatile and can be used in various industries, including automotive, industrial automation, telecommunication, and power distribution. They serve as a bridge between low-voltage control circuits and high-voltage power circuits, ensuring safe and efficient operation.

      **What is a Fire-rated Wiring Duct?**

      A fire-rated wiring duct is a specialized conduit designed to protect electrical wiring from fire damage. These ducts are made from materials that have high fire resistance properties, such as intumescent or fire-resistant plastics, and are tested to meet specific fire safety standards.

      **Types of Fire-rated Wiring Ducts**

      1. **Intumescent Fire-rated Wiring Ducts**: These ducts are filled with a material that expands when exposed to heat, forming a char layer that insulates the wiring and delays the spread of fire.

      2. **Fire-resistant Plastic Fire-rated Wiring Ducts**: These ducts are made from plastics that have been treated to enhance their fire-resistant properties. They do not expand like intumescent ducts but still provide a certain level of fire protection.

      3. **Metallic Fire-rated Wiring Ducts**: These ducts are made from metals such as steel or aluminum and offer excellent fire protection. They are suitable for high-risk areas where maximum fire protection is required.
